WebThe invisible stitch, also known as the ladder, slip, blind, or hidden stitch is a commonly used hand sewing stitch. With needle pointing to the left ( right ), take up a very small bit of the garment fabric just above the fold of the hem. Try to make your stitch very small as it will be visible from the right side. Pull up thread. Move the needle a bit to the right ( left) – about 1/4″ to 1/2”. the place of a skull

Web14 de nov. de 2024 · 3. Slip Stitch hem. This is another invisible hem stitch and the best option when sewing sheer fabrics or thin and lightweight fabrics. This stitch is made with the needle slipping inside the fold of the …
